Abstract
A kind of turbine steam seal cooler, the cooling cylinder for including cooling tube including one, pass through flange respectively at the both ends of the cooling cylinder and is connected to end socket, the cooling cylinder is horizontal arrangement, it wherein cools down respectively in accordance with a cooling water inlet setting up and down and a cooling water outlet on the end socket linkage section wall of cylinder side, and the cooling water inlet and outlet are separately connected built-in cooling tube;By the way that overlapped, Stent Implantation has a blower connecting by threeway valve group, snorkel with the cooling cylinder side above the cooling cylinder;Gland-packing leakage entrance is provided on the cooling cylinder other side;Two side lower parts of the cooling cylinder are respectively arranged with the brandreth stabilizer blade being fixed on ground by ground glue bolt, fixed configurations have water connecting flange to the cooling water inlet and cooling water outlet respectively, it is built in that the intracorporal cooling tube of cooling cylinder is axially extending and the circle that at least unrolls is connect in cooling cylinder body by disk, forms a pipe shell type heat exchange device.

Background technique
In gland-sealing cooler, working medium is usually the mixture of air and steam, the main function of gland-sealing cooler be exactly and
When it is the steam in mixture is cooling and incondensable gas therein is discharged except therrmodynamic system, to guarantee that unit connects
Continuous, safe and effective operation;It is currently used for the gland-sealing cooler of steam turbine, mainly includes cooling cylinder, blower, pipeline, vapour
Envelope cooler is heat exchanger and is connected with cooling water, and gland-sealing cooler is connected to by pipeline with the high-pressure steam seal of steam turbine, packing
Equipped with blower etc. on cooler;Structure is complicated mostly for the gland-sealing cooler of above structure composition, and production cost is larger, Er Qieleng
But effect is general.
